Is courage a abstract noun?

Yes, courage is an abstract noun. Abstract nouns refer to concepts, qualities, or states that cannot be perceived through the five senses, and courage represents the quality of having the ability to confront fear or adversity. Unlike concrete nouns, which denote tangible objects, courage embodies an idea or feeling.

What actions define courageous people?

We should start by defining what courage is not. Courage is not being fearless or never retreating. It is not "acting like a man" or winning every fight. Instead, courage is feeling your fears and having the convictions to do the right thing and press on. It is making difficult decisions when they are important and need to be made.
